Rapper Rick Ross has many people upset with the recent release of his song “Holy Ghost.” He has been criticized for twisting scriptures and using God  in the song as a means for committing sins.

The first verse of the song depicts Ross, a self-proclaimed Christian, relishing in the riches of sitting in his expensive Bugatti as he makes a drug deal. Proclaiming that being “dead broke” is the “root of all evil” instead of the love of money, he is attempting to dodge cops and asks for the Holy Ghost to intervene.
